A leading defence organization is seeking skilled Embedded Software V&V Engineers for an initial 6-month contract based in the UK. You will focus on verification and validation of real-time systems application software for missile systems.
Ideal candidates will have:
- Strong experience in V&V activities
- Experience in embedded software development using C, C++ or Ada
- The ability to turn requirements into structured test cases
The position offers a hybrid work model and a competitive rate of £70 per hour.
